i think the xkey.cfg file i have been using is an old one. it didn't have the HDKEEPALIVE option listed at all.
i have been having a few random console restart issues and figured maybe my hdd going to sleep was the cause of my problems.
i've done some research and found out about this option and added the lines of text to my xkey.cfg file.
the problem is the default value is set HDKEEPALIVE=0 and i gather that means zero seconds, which means the option is disabled.
could anyone please let me know a good value for HDKEEPALIVE?
